Linzor Capital Partners and co-investors have acquired 100% of Mundo Pacifico, a Chilean telecommunications provider, to enhance its fiber-to-the-home services in a rapidly growing market.

Target Information

Mundo Pacifico is a leading Chilean company dedicated to providing residential telecommunication services through high-speed fiber-to-the-home (FTTH) connections. This company offers a comprehensive suite of services, including broadband internet with speeds of up to 1,000 Mbps, pay television, and voice services. It boasts an extensive network that reaches over one million homes, supported by more than 11,000 kilometers of fiber-optic infrastructure throughout Chile.
